Output 1ecaa66390e8e20ac062c4194c46af7ae90048cdde03612d2c94de4cba5c0b72:1

value
14590994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13f6abbde2b2ea1819de3a7e7eed3c23756775ac OP_EQUAL
address
33WaGBSQ3rJmhkcp288PpBARQQ1LdedrDY
transaction
1ecaa66390e8e20ac062c4194c46af7ae90048cdde03612d2c94de4cba5c0b72
confirmations
218349
spent
true